South African Archbishop Desmond Tutu dies
The 1984 Nobel Peace Prize winner and Archbishop Desmond Tutu of South Africa passed away today at the age of 90. South African President Rama Phosha has confirmed this news.
Desmond Mpilo Tutu, formerly translated by Tu Demin, is the Emeritus Archbishop of the Anglican Diocese of Cape Town and the first African-American Archbishop of the Anglican Church of South Africa. He is known as the pioneer of human rights theology. Tu Tu is also the winner of the 1984 Nobel Peace Prize. He has been committed to abolishing the apartheid policy in South Africa since the 1980s. In 1995, he began to lead the "Truth and Reconciliation Commission" to promote the transitional justice in South Africa and is well-known in the world.
